Published purpose

March 24, 2011 - Through this operation, the United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ees (UNHCR) will promote international protection for all refugees and asylum seekers in the region, seek durable solutions for refugees, particularly through local integration and resettlement, and ensure that other vulnerable people of concern in the region enjoy their basic rights. UNHCR's strategy in the region is based on the Mexico Plan of Action, which focuses on supporting local integration and self-reliance of vulnerable populations in need of international protection in urban areas, providing protection in sensitive border areas (particularly with Colombia and its neighbours), and offering resettlement opportunities for persons facing protection risks. CIDA’s contribution is helping UNHCR to support the implementation of a comprehensive response to situations of displacement in the region. UNHCR also seeks to support local integration and self-reliance of vulnerable populations in need of international protection in urban areas. Activities include: providing basic healthcare, shelter, and assisting in the integration and repatriation of refugees to their country of origin; working with national authorities to strengthen legal frameworks that protect displaced populations; and, advocating for the rights of refugees and working with government officials to better address asylum issues.
